The Great Barrier Reef is no aquarium—it’s a vast, living entity so large it’s visible from space. The heart of the ocean, it’s wild and unforgettable, offering endless opportunities for discovery. Beneath your fins, vibrant coral sprawls, alive with fish that dart and swirl like neon confetti. Turtles glide with the serenity of ancient mariners, while sleek sharks cruise nearby. The big creatures—manta rays, whale sharks, and dugongs—add to the magic. And if you’re lucky enough to dive between November and March, you might witness a coral spawning, an awe-inspiring underwater blizzard of new life.
